Manaal Origin and Meaning
Manaal is a feminine name of Arabic origin meaning 'achievement', 'attainment', or 'something acquired'. It's particularly popular in Muslim communities across the Middle East, South Asia, and among Muslim diaspora worldwide. The name carries inspirational connotations of success and accomplishment, making it an aspirational choice for parents. Manaal has gained increasing popularity in recent decades as parents seek names with both beautiful sounds and meaningful origins. The name has a melodious quality with its flowing syllables while remaining relatively uncommon in Western countries.
